Explaining The
Importance of Donations

Here your kindness is amplified. Five dollars helps provide 20 nutritious meals—thanks to hundreds of relationships with local food and grocery partners. Three hours of volunteering cooks up mountains of baked chicken, piles of potatoes, a gazillion greens and hundreds of yummy meals for homebound and senior neighbors. And a few hours in the warehouse helps deliver thousands of BackPacks to our youngest neighbors. Here your generosity makes a big difference across Central Virginia.

Thanks to the incredible support received during this year’s Puritan Cleaners 100K Meals campaign, more Central Virginia children will have access to nourishing meals this summer. Each spring, Puritan Cleaners rallies our community to raise food and funds for local families in need, and this year’s campaign delivered a truly remarkable result: more than 231,000 meals raised for the children and families we serve.
